This volume collects sixty-four essays by the author, including The Perfect Assumption, Dreams of a Night Walker, Antinomies in Literature, Reading Hygiene Guidelines, and When Robots Form a Writers' Association. The book is divided into three sections: "e;On Society and History,"e; "e;On Life and Morality,"e; and "e;On Literature and Culture."e;Essays have been Han Shaogong's primary literary form over the past two decades, offering profound reflections and incisive critiques of China's social and cultural transformation during its transition period. His work carries a weighty sense of the times and possesses a profoundly moving human dimension.Through realist brushstrokes, he captures life's realities and reflections; through the tension of his thought, he engages in philosophical speculation and profound intellectual enlightenment; and through his unique linguistic artistry, he offers insights into human nature and historical inquiry. Some representative works, with their distinctive style and strong individuality, rival the finest essays since the May Fourth Movement. They demonstrate extraordinary wisdom and profound contemplation across various themes-society and history, life and morality, literature and culture.
